Application form for recognition of student status by UNamur
Reminder This form is not valid for applications for recognition:as a special-needs student - with a disability, managed by the CMP.as a student-entrepreneur, managed by the EMCP Faculty.The file must be complete at the time of application. Make sure you have compiled all the necessary documents in a single PDF file before completing this form. The documents required are stipulated on the page "Student status", paragraph "status types and grant conditions). For commitment requests, a letter of motivation must also be attached to your file.At the end of the form, you will be asked to agree to respect the rules that set out the commitments arising from the recognition of a particular status to a student by UNamur. Information is available on the page Status of student", paragraph "Charter".

Charter for the recognition of student status
This charter sets out the commitments arising from UNamur's recognition of a student's special status. Both parties undertake to respect the provisions of this charter.UNamur's commitmentsThe University of Namur undertakes to:Officially recognize the granting of status;Implement reasonable accommodations according to its available resources and the student's individual situation.Student commitments The student undertakes to:Solicit reasonable and proportional accommodations in relation to his or her situation;Report any changes in his or her situation that could have an impact on the recognition of his or her status;Do not neglect his or her academic performance as a result of the recognition of status;Write a report, at the end of the academic year, on what the recognition of status as well as the accommodations he or she has benefited from has or has not brought him or her. This report should be sent to the Vice-Rector for Student Affairs.
